摘要:
Little is known about the role of p38MAPK in human adipocyte di. fferentiation. Here we showed that p38MAPK activity increases during human preadipocytes differentiation. Pharmacological inhibition of p38MAPK during adipocyte differentiation of primary human preadipocytes markedly reduced triglycerides accumulation and adipocyte markers expression. Cell cycle arrest or proliferation was not a. ffected by p38MAPK inhibition. Although induction of C/EBP beta was not altered by the p38MAPK inhibitor, its phosphorylation on Threonine 188 was decreased as well as PPAR gamma expression. These results indicate that p38MAPK plays a positive role in human adipogenesis through regulation of C/EBP beta and PPAR gamma factors. (c) 2007 Federation of European Biochemical Societies.
